S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 598
WHEREAS, The Senate of the State of Texas is pleased to recognize Dr. Dana Carson and joins the citizens of Alvin in welcoming him to their community; and WHEREAS, Dr. Carson is being honored during Shepherd's Week for his 17 years of ministry in Austin and his first year of ministry in Alvin; and WHEREAS, This special week of events is an opportunity for Alvin residents to show appreciation for Dr. Carson's arrival and to hear his inspirational message; a man of spiritual depth and devotion, his guidance over the years has brought enlightenment and hope to many Christians; and WHEREAS, The ministry that Dr. Carson is establishing in Alvin is Reflections of Christ's Kingdom; it will include life skills programs and a family life center that will benefit Alvin and the surrounding communities; and WHEREAS, Dr. Carson's outstanding community leadership and his ministry in Austin will be recognized during the formal banquet on April 11 that concludes the week's events; and WHEREAS, A man who has dedicated his life to his religious calling, Dr. Carson has made a difference in the lives of countless Texans;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 78th Legislature, hereby commend Dr. Dana Carson for his fervent service to his church, his fellowman, and his community; and, be it further R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ared for him as an expression of esteem from the Texas Senate.
